Amplified Momentum: New Funding and Product Innovations

The past few months have seen a flood of significant funding rounds and noteworthy product launches that underscore a broader industry commitment to trustworthy autonomy:

  • Guild.ai, an agentic AI startup specializing in development of autonomous AI agents, secured $44 million in a combination of seed and Series A funding. Valued at approximately $300 million, Guild.ai is focused on enabling enterprises to develop trustworthy, domain-specific AI agents that can operate independently while adhering to governance and compliance standards.

  • JetStream Security, a Santa Clara-based AI governance platform, raised $34 million in a seed round. Their platform emphasizes secure, compliant, and transparent autonomous AI workflows, addressing the critical need for governance frameworks in increasingly autonomous AI ecosystems.

  • Worldscape.ai, specializing in geospatial intelligence for defense, government, and enterprise, announced a seed funding round aimed at accelerating their defense and enterprise geospatial platforms. Their technology supports autonomous analysis of complex geospatial data, enabling real-time decisioning in defense and critical infrastructure.

Infrastructure and Sovereignty: Advancing Hardware and Space-Enabled Ecosystems

Parallel to software innovations, regional investments focus heavily on hardware sovereignty, secure compute infrastructure, and space-based data centers:

  • India committed $1.2 billion to develop indigenous AI hardware through Neysa, aiming to foster regional autonomy and tailored autonomous ecosystems aligned with local needs.

  • Korea’s The Invention Lab supports Singapore-based RIDM in deploying scalable AI compute infrastructure, ensuring hardware resilience and regional sovereignty.

  • Israel continues its leadership in security-focused AI systems, with startups like Solid raising $20 million to develop autonomous, secure systems for defense and critical infrastructure.

  • Southeast Asia and Middle East hubs such as Build In SE and Hub71 in Abu Dhabi are cultivating region-specific AI startups that prioritize sovereign infrastructure supporting both public and private sectors.

Orbital Data Centers and Satellite Connectivity

Innovations in orbital compute infrastructure are gaining momentum:

  • Sophia Space raised $10 million to develop modular orbital data centers designed for low-latency, resilient compute infrastructure beyond terrestrial limits, supporting disaster recovery and autonomous operations in remote or underserved regions.

  • Satellite networks, led by startups with former SpaceX engineers, attracted $50 million in funding to provide high-speed, global connectivity—enabling autonomous AI ecosystems in areas lacking terrestrial infrastructure.

  • Vervesemi and C2i Semiconductors continue to push forward with energy-efficient AI chips optimized for edge deployment and data center performance, laying the foundational hardware for trustworthy, resilient autonomous ecosystems.


Autonomous Orchestration and Public Safety: From Pilot to Production

The focus on multi-agent autonomous systems extends into public safety, security, and regulatory compliance:

  • Unicity Labs and Reload advance decentralized autonomous agent networks, emphasizing resilience and security in multi-agent coordination.

  • Contents, a European startup, secured €7 million to develop trustworthy AI orchestration tools ensuring compliant autonomous workflows across diverse industries.

  • Multitude Insights raised $10 million for AI-powered public safety platforms that enable inter-jurisdictional intelligence sharing—fostering faster threat response and collaborative security.

Turning Pilots into Business Results: The Maturation of Autonomous AI

A pivotal recent milestone is the announcement by Dyna.Ai, a Singapore-based AI solutions provider, of closing its Series A funding. This marks a notable shift from pilot projects to scalable, revenue-generating solutions:

"Dyna.Ai’s Series A funding signifies a key step in translating autonomous AI experiments into real-world, operational systems," said CEO Jane Lim. "Our goal is to deploy autonomous decision systems that deliver measurable value across Asia."

Dyna.Ai has been instrumental in enterprise decision intelligence, with pilots in finance and supply chain management. The new funding will accelerate full deployment, embedding trustworthy, autonomous workflows directly into clients' core operations—highlighting the industry’s trend of maturing autonomous AI from prototype to production.
